Capacity of VoIP in IEEE 802.11 Wireless LAN
Chen Liquan,Hu Aiqun,Zhou Xueli
Strategic Study of CAE 2005, Volume 7, Issue 7, Pages 81-85
Voice transmitted over wireless LAN faces serious challenge because of the fluctuation of the wireless channel. In this paper, the transmission of voice over wireless LAN is firstly analyzed. Taking collision probability into account, the stochastic analysis based on a Markov chain to calculate the upper bound number of simultaneous VoIP calls that can be supported in a single cell of an IEEE 802. llb/a/g network is proposed. The upper bound capacities of G. 711, G. 729 and G. 723.1 code transmitted over 802. llb/a/g are figured out. The simulation results from NS2 simulator have validated the analysis values.
Keywords: wireless LAN voice over IP capacity Markov chain

Research and Realization of IP Multicast Routing Protocol
Li Wei
Strategic Study of CAE 2002, Volume 4, Issue 1, Pages 82-88
This paper first explains why IP multicasting must be used.Then it summaries the fundamentals of IP multicasting and multicast routing protocols.Finally it discusses the problems and prospect of IP multicasting.
